Contractors will be able to point to these new guidelines when communicating with their clients so they know what to expect of the final instal- lation and how to perform a rea- sonable inspection of the finished work. While most tile contractors strive to achieve 100% accuracy and quality in every installation, small issues do occur. After all, these are hand-crafted installations with many variables to consider and pieces to assemble. There are rea- sonable allowances for variation. When I receive the next question about a tiny chip or perceived flaw in an installation I can refer to the new language in the 2017 TCNA Handbook to form my response. And so can you. For the next question I receive about viewing a tile installa- tion, I can now point contractors and installers to the new “Visual Inspection of Tilework” section in the 2017 TCNA Handbook. When it is an owner or owner’s repre- sentative that calls, the Handbook backs up my comments about leaving the halogen lights in the garage and use only permanently- installed lighting and to not get down on their hands and knees with grandpa’s magnifying glass but to view the installation from 60” or normal standing height from floors or 36” from walls.
